Cheatham is the 2,923rd most common surname in the United States, shared by 12,024 people at the 2020 census. That is about one person in 24,900.

Where the name comes from

From Middle English, variant of Cheetham, from historical Cheetham in Lancashire, from Chet + ham; first element from cel-bry/cel *cęd (“wood, forest”), from Proto-Celtic *kaitos, from Proto-Indo-European *kayt-, *ḱayt- (“forest, wasteland, pasture”), related to Latin bucetum.

Source: US Census Bureau, Frequently Occurring Surnames, 2020. The Census describes the file as the surnames borne by 100 or more people; rarer names are not published. The line is not quite exact, and 617 published names come in under it, the smallest at 92 people. Race and Hispanic origin are self-reported. Rates are worked out against the 298.9 million people the file's own figures are calculated on, which is fewer than the census counted in all: the difference is everyone whose surname was too rare to publish.
